Output decb9ae962da25a704cb5ff0564b8fbf391a3e25cf5808a43d5ece9caca30dc1:0

value
16605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85acf9400888554273d47c0f383d0bc21bab872d OP_EQUAL
address
3Dsq1UZKDyXESgMNNfYjeXQBVbyQaAoBCq
transaction
decb9ae962da25a704cb5ff0564b8fbf391a3e25cf5808a43d5ece9caca30dc1
confirmations
249192
spent
true